The complexity of dry eye makes it challenging to explain to patients why they have the problem. Danger factors are not just variable in their total number however also in their frequency, as some lifestyle and environmental threat factors can wax and wind down with seasons or the patient's aesthetic, work-related and way of living needs.


Persistence is required with numerous academic touch points. The drivers behind non-compliance are not black and white as well as are special to every patient. Like DED itself, non-compliance often tends to be multifactorial. Physicians can be guilty of over-simplifying why individuals fail to follow referrals instead than attempting to better comprehend why they don't.


The study discovered the mean blink prices for the low need task were 8. When the subjects were presented with material requiring boost cognitive demand, the mean blink prices lowered significantly to 7.

 

 

 

 


They have a persistent problem without a treatment that, if serious enough, needs interest and actions modification for the direct future. Research shows DED comes with a significant burden, both physically as well as monetarily. It can impair physical and mental performance and also, in moderate-to-severe disease, can have signs comparable to serious migraine.

Dr. Carter states that her rate of interest in vision treatment dates back to very early youth when she was treated for esotropia with her very first set of hyperopic glasses at a young age.

 

 

 

Optometry Podcasts for Dummies


This personal experience has caused an enthusiasm in aid others accomplish binocular vision. For ODs considering including vision therapy to their techniques, Dr. Carter motivates them to jump done in." There are 2 roadways to take: You are either all in, or you refer out," she states. "Individuals who attempt to just meddle vision treatment, to be honest, are the ones who give VT a poor name.


Carter recommends purchasing extreme proceeding education curricula and/or residency programs prior to supplying this solution to patients. If that academic financial investment sounds like greater than what ODs wish to tackle, she suggests they educate themselves on the questions to ask to understand if a patient would take advantage of vision treatment, and then refer out to an expert in their area.


Carter suggests medical professionals to pay attention for uncommon aesthetic issues or for vision concerns following concussions and also asking every youngster in the examination chair if they such as to review. Dr. Carter sees for excessive head movement with pursuits and also examinations near factor of merging to get a quick idea of how the eyes and mind are coordinating (or not).


She does not have an optical, as well as she does decline handled vision treatment strategies. Referring medical professionals do not require to be specialists in what vision treatment involves. She suggests telling clients: "As a part of your examination today, we found that your eyes aren't working well with each other, and also I have a professional that can teach your eyes exactly how to do that properly to make sure that you aren't needing to work so hard (Defocus Media Group) (http://aulavirtual.cali.edu.co/index.php/comunicacion/foro/defocus-media-1)." Additionally, offering a pamphlet or individual sign listing to referring physicians can be verifying for a person or a moms and dad to identify their youngster will certainly profit from this recommendation.
